Colorado Prosecutors Charge 11-Year-Old With First-Degree Murder in 5-Year-Old Brother's Death

The rare juvenile case will proceed in closed court with few details released.

Overview

  • Prosecutors in Arapahoe County filed a first-degree murder charge against the boy over the death of his 5-year-old brother, Elias.
  • Media reports say the younger child was killed in his sleep in early March after the brothers returned home from school.
  • The 11-year-old is being held in juvenile detention, and a juvenile-court conviction could mean up to seven years in custody.
  • Hearings are expected to be closed to protect the minor and family, and officials have not released a motive or method.
  • Defense attorneys call the charge extremely unusual and say prosecutors must prove the child intended to kill.
